Максим И. Frontend разработчик, Middle+

ID 32961
МИ
Максим И.
Мужчина, 35 лет
Россия, Санкт-Петербург, UTC+3
Ставка
2 701,3 Р/час
НДС не облагается
Специалист доступен с 29 октября 2025 г.

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.

Подробнее
О специалисте
Специализация
Frontend разработчик
Грейд
Middle+
Навыки
JavaScript
TypeScript
React
Git
HTML
CSS
HTML5
HTML5/CSSS
CSS3
Effector
Jest
jestwebpack
jest/enzyme
Material UI
Material UI (MUI)
Ant design
Ant Design (antd)
AntD
Antd Design
Ant Design Charts
AntD Chart
antd form
antd-formik
 antd
Ant.design
DevExpress
DevExpress components
Leaflet.js
React-leaflet
react leaflet
OpenStreetMap
Chart.js
Webpack
Webpack (Module Federation)
webpack 5
Webpack Module Federation
Webpack 3,4,5 (chunks, import files)
React-Webpack
ESLint
eslint-plugin-html
eslint-plugin-prettier
ESLint 9.16.0
Prettier
Vite
Vitest
vitetest
Figma
Husky
GitLab
GitHub
Bitbucket
Gitlab CI
GitLab CI/CD
GitHub Actions
Agile
Agile (Scrum, Kanban)
Agile/Scrum
Методологии Agile
Scrum
Adaptive layout
Adaptive UI
Адаптивная верстка
Адаптивная и кроссбраузерная верстка
Адаптивная и отзывчивая верстка
Кросс-браузерная разработка
Кроссбраузерная верстка
оптимизация
Оптимизация кода
оптимизация производительности приложения
Оптимизация ПО
Code Review
Рефакторинг
рефакторинг кода
REST API
REST
REST API и Webhook- интеграции
Swagger (REST API)
Axios for REST API
SPA
Разработка адаптивов сайта
Разработка
Разработка библиотек
Разработка и проектирование
Разработка ПО
gis
map
Map services
dashboards
Построение дашбордов
Styled Components
Sass
Axios.js
Jira
React Native
React Native Maps
React Native Testing Library
React Native Navigator
React Native FileSystem
Отрасли
Cloud Services
Government & Public Sector
Logistics & Transport
Manufacturing
Знание языков
Английский — B1
Главное о специалисте
Frontend-разработчик с 4+ годами коммерческого опыта, специализирующийся на создании сложных веб-приложений на React и TypeScript. Основная экспертиза включает разработку аналитических дашбордов и картографических интерфейсов с использованием Leaflet и OpenStreetMap. Участвовал в полном цикле разработки от концепции до запуска в таких областях, как Business Intelligence и геоинформационные системы. Владеет современным стеком технологий включая Effector, Material UI, Jest и Webpack. Ответственный разработчик, способный работать как самостоятельно, так и в команде, с фокусом на производительность и качество кода.
Проекты   (4 года 1 месяц)
ARDB "Road"
Роль
Frontend Developer
Обязанности
Описание проекта: Разработка и развитие фронтенд-части государственной системы управления дорожным хозяйством с комплексной аналитикой и отчетностью Команда: Frontend-разработчики (4), Backend-разработчики (5), Аналитики (3), Team Lead, Project Manager Обязанности: - Разработка новых модулей и функциональности - Создание интерактивных таблиц и отчетов - Интеграция картографических компонентов - Рефакторинг и оптимизация существующего кода Технологии: React, TypeScript, Ant Design, Material UI, Leaflet, OpenStreetMap, Effector, Jest
Достижения
Достижения: - Разработал систему интерактивных таблиц с использованием Material UI и Ant Design, обрабатывающих до 10 000+ записей - Реализовал модуль загрузки и превью медиафайлов, поддерживающий 5+ форматов изображений и видео - Провел рефакторинг 70% кодовой базы, что улучшило поддерживаемость и сократило количество багов на 25%
Стек специалиста на проекте
Jest, TypeScript, OpenStreetMap, Базы данных, Ant design, Аналитика, Leaflet.js, Material UI, Рефакторинг, Frontend, React, Effector, Работа с интеграциями, Разработка, Ревью
Отрасль проекта
Government & Public Sector
Период работы
Июль 2023 - По настоящее время  (2 года 4 месяца)
ND Analytic System
Роль
Frontend Developer
Обязанности
Описание проекта: Разработка комплексной аналитической платформы с персонализированными дашбордами для визуализации бизнес-метрик и статистических данных Команда: Frontend-разработчики (3), Backend-разработчики (4), Аналитики (2), Team Lead Обязанности: - Полный цикл разработки фронтенд-части приложения - Создание динамических дашбордов с интерактивными виджетами - Разработка системы авторизации и управления доступом - Оптимизация производительности и рефакторинг кодовой базы Технологии: React, TypeScript, Effector, Chart.js, Material UI, Webpack, Jest
Достижения
Достижения: - Реализовал систему персонализированных дашбордов с 15+ типами виджетов, что позволило клиентам настраивать интерфейс под конкретные бизнес-задачи - Разработал модуль авторизации с поддержкой ролевой модели, обеспечивающий безопасный доступ для 1000+ пользователей - Оптимизировал загрузку данных, сократив время отклика интерфейса на 40% через реализацию эффективного кэширования
Стек специалиста на проекте
JavaScript, Jest, Webpack, Chart.js, TypeScript, Базы данных, Аналитика, Material UI, Business intelligence, Рефакторинг, Frontend, React, Effector, разработка системы, Разработка, Построение дашбордов, разработчик
Отрасль проекта
Cloud Services
Период работы
Апрель 2022 - По настоящее время  (3 года 7 месяцев)
Mobile GIS
Роль
Frontend Developer
Обязанности
Описание проекта: Разработка мобильного картографического приложения для визуализации пространственных данных и управления географическими объектами Команда: Frontend-разработчики (2), Backend-разработчики (3), Mobile-разработчики (2), Дизайнер Обязанности: - Интеграция картографических компонентов с бэкенд-сервисами - Разработка UI для работы с картографическими слоями - Реализация кэширования картографических данных - Оптимизация производительности для мобильных устройств Технологии: JavaScript, Leaflet, OpenStreetMap, React, TypeScript, Webpack
Достижения
Достижения: - Интегрировал фронтенд-компоненты на JavaScript с C# бэкендом, обеспечив стабильную работу картографического движка - Реализовал систему кэширования тайлов карты, что уменьшило трафик на 60% и ускорило загрузку карт - Добавил поддержку различных геометрических объектов (полигоны, линии, точки) с интерактивным взаимодействием
Стек специалиста на проекте
JavaScript, C#, Webpack, TypeScript, OpenStreetMap, UI, Leaflet.js, Frontend, React, Работа с интеграциями, Разработка, Мобильное приложение
Отрасль проекта
Logistics & Transport
Период работы
Сентябрь 2022 - Июнь 2023  (10 месяцев)
Формат работы
Тип занятости
Фулл-тайм, Парт-тайм (6 ч/день)
Формат работы
Удаленно, Офис
Командировки
Готов
Релокация
Не готов
Готов работать на зарубежных проектах
Да
Образование
Среднее
Учебное заведение
Московский техникум космического машиностроения (МТКМ)
Специальность
Радиоэлектронные приборные устройства, Радиотехнолог
Завершение учебы
2009 г.
Высшее
Учебное заведение
Московский финансово-промышленный университет "Синергия", Москва
Специальность
Менеджмент организаций, Управление персоналом
Завершение учебы
2014 г.
Дополнительное
Учебное заведение
Algoritmika Coding Bootcamp
Специальность
Frontend-developer
Завершение учебы
2021 г.

Похожие специалисты

BioTech, Pharma, Health care & Sports • E-commerce & Retail • Information Security • Insurance • Logistics & Transport • Telecom
СК
Сергей К.
Севастополь
Frontend разработчик
Senior
2 142,86 Р/час
React
Системная интеграция
Redux
Jest
Testing
Webpack
TypeScript
Информационные технологии
Ревью
UI
+72

Опытный frontend-разработчик, специализируется на React. Участвовал в разработке программного обеспечения для различных проектов, включая: - Positive Technologies: разработка кабинета партнёра и кабинета администратора, работа по SCRUM в команде из 16 человек. - МТС RED ASOC: платформа управления безопасной разработкой. - Global IT Support: создание платформы управления заказами и поставками, разработка CRM. - CodeMicros: оптимизация внутренних процессов лечебного учреждения. - Avenga: телемедицина. Обладает навыками работы с Redux, Redux-Toolkit, Next.js, Jest, React-testing-library,Three.js, Webpack, Prettier и другими инструментами. Умеет проводить код-ревью, оптимизировать код, создавать техническую документацию.

Подробнее
FinTech & Banking
МД
Максим Д.
Москва
Frontend разработчик
Senior
2 954,3 Р/час
Agile
Allure
Ant design
avascript
Bash
CSS Modules
Cypress
Figma
FSD
Git
+77

Фронтенд разработчик с 5ю годами опыта к c опытом создания проектов с нуля от проектирования архитектуры до запуска в продакшн на стеке React, Redux, TypeScript. - За это время успел поработать в разных продуктовых компаниях. Работал в командах от 10 от 30 человек, работа в которых строилась по scrum методологии со всеми привычными созвонами и активностями. Самые технически сложные и интересные задачи из моего опыта: 1) Разработал план проекта с архитектурой FSD с 0, онбординг новых сотрудников стал быстрее и мои наработки переняли другие команды (Сбер миграция SAP), составил документацию 2) Разработал и реализовал план переезда с обычной архитектуры на FSD, разработка стала на много быстрее и ориентироваться в проекте стало легче (Личный кабинет ипотечного заемщика ГПБ) 3) Переписал классический redux на toolkit+react-query, уменьшился объем кода и за счет кеширования query уменьшилась нагрузка на сервер, также понимание кода стало проще за счет более удобного синтаксиса(Сбер ДБО\иб вклады) 4) Перевод Микрофронта на новую версию шаблонов, технически муторная задача, Микрофронт не обновлялся от шаблона год, придя на этот проект сделал эту задачу, что позволило понять архитектуру проекта и работу с микрофронтами в стриме в кротчайшие сроки (Сбер ДБО\иб вклады) 5)Имею большой опыт и глубокие знания в написании unit тестов, рефакторинге и написании масштабируемого кода, react/redux/typescript и тд Есть опыт с MobX и effector, работал с микрофронтами В командах ежедневно вел коммуникацию в BE разработчиками и другими членами команды, декомпозировал и оценивал свои задачи, участвовал в проектировании фич\рефакторинга и компонентов

Подробнее
Cloud Services • HRTech • Logistics & Transport • RnD
АК
Алексей К.
Ижевск
Frontend разработчик
Middle+
2 857,14 Р/час
Adobe XD
Ant design
Apollo
ASP.NET Core
Backend
Banners
BEM
Bitbucket
Brotli
C#
+101

Ключевые навыки Frontend-разработка: HTML5, CSS3, JavaScript (ES6+), TypeScript React.js, Next.js, Redux Toolkit, MobX, Zustand, Svelte React Native – кроссплатформенная разработка мобильных приложений GraphQL (Apollo, Relay), REST API, WebSockets Code Splitting, Lazy Loading, React.memo, useMemo, useCallback UI/UX и стилизация: Ant Design, Material UI, Chakra UI – готовые UI-библиотеки SASS, LESS, PostCSS, Tailwind CSS, Styled Components, Emotion, Linaria BEM, SMACSS, ITCSS – методологии CSS Figma, Zeplin, Adobe XD – работа с UI-макетами Backend и базы данных (основы): Node.js, Express.js, NestJS – написание серверной логики C#, ASP.NET Core – взаимодействие с backend PostgreSQL, MongoDB – работа с базами данных Инфраструктура: Git, GitHub, GitLab, Bitbucket – контроль версий, code review Docker, Docker Compose, CI/CD (GitHub Actions, GitLab CI, Jenkins) Nginx, PM2 – настройка серверов для фронтенда Vercel, Netlify, Firebase – деплой и хостинг Тестирование и качество кода: Cypress, Jest, React Testing Library – E2E, unit и интеграционное тестирование Storybook – изолированное тестирование UI-компонентов ESLint, Prettier, Husky, lint-staged – линтеры и прекоммит-хуки Оптимизация и производительность: Tree shaking, minification, gzip, Brotli – оптимизация бандла Virtualized lists (React Window, React Virtualized) – работа с большими списками Оптимизация CI/CD, сокращение времени сборки Аналитика и SEO: Google Analytics, Yandex Metrika – интеграция и анализ SEO-оптимизация, мета-теги, Open Graph, микроразметка GDPR, Cookie Banner, Privacy Policies

Подробнее

Недавно просмотренные специалисты

Blockchain • HRTech
МП
Марина П.
Брест
React разработчик
Middle+
3 376,62 Р/час
MobX
методологии
HTML5
Agile/Scrum
React testing library
Redux
GraphQL
Документирование
верстка
DevTools
+39

Марина — React-разработчик уровня Middle+ из Бреста, Беларусь. Специализируется на фронтенде, обладает опытом работы в отраслях Blockchain и HRTech. Ключевые навыки включают работу с Agile/Scrum, API, Apollo, Backend, Bootstrap, Chrome DevTools, CI/CD, Code Review, CSS Modules, CSS-in-JS, DevTools, GraphQL, HTML5, JavaScript, Jest, Jira, Management, MobX, Node.js, Npm, React, React Testing Library, Redux, REST, Styled Components, Testing, TypeScript, Unit testing, useCallback, Webpack. Имеет опыт работы на двух проектах: - DreamTeam Development (Blockchain, 1 год 6 месяцев): разрабатывала и поддерживала веб-приложение для агрегации бенефитов с использованием React 18 и TypeScript. Провела рефакторинг компонентов, внедрила React Query, реализовала Dark Mode, исправила критические баги, написала unit-тесты, интегрировала Google Places API, оптимизировала сборку приложения через настройку Webpack. - NDA (HRTech, 1 год): разрабатывала с нуля модуль управления бенефитами на стеке React/Redux/GraphQL, интегрировала Google Autocomplete API и Stripe, создала HR-инструмент для управления задачами, провела код-ревью, реализовала систему тестирования, участвовала в Agile-процессах.

Подробнее